Ileocecal Paracoccidioidomycosis Presenting as a Pseudotumoral Lesion in a Pediatric Patient: A Histopathological Diagnostic Challenge.

Source abstract
Ileocecal pseudotumoral lesions in pediatric patients pose a significant diagnostic challenge, particularly in endemic regions where infectious and neoplastic conditions overlap. Gastrointestinal paracoccidioidomycosis (PCM) is rare and may closely mimic intestinal tuberculosis or malignancy, leading to potential misdiagnosis. We report a 14-year-old girl presenting with constitutional symptoms and imaging findings of ileocecal wall thickening with mesenteric lymphadenopathy. Endoscopy revealed ulceroinfiltrative lesions suggestive of neoplasia. Histopathological evaluation demonstrated granulomatous inflammation with multinucleated giant cells and abundant yeast forms. A critical diagnostic pitfall arose during special staining: Grocott-Gomori methenamine silver staining produced a pseudohalo around the fungal elements due to cytoplasmic retraction and optical clearing of the thick fungal cell wall, mimicking the capsular appearance of Cryptococcus spp. Periodic acid-Schiff staining resolved this ambiguity by clearly demonstrating the characteristic multibudding "pilot wheel" morphology of Paracoccidioides spp., and mucicarmine negativity definitively excluded a polysaccharide capsule, ruling out cryptococcosis. This example underscores the interpretive value of a sequential histochemical staining approach in distinguishing morphologically overlapping fungi, and highlights PCM as an essential differential diagnosis in ileocecal masses within endemic settings, particularly in pediatric populations.
